Management Electives,
Directed Electives, OR
a Minor in Another
Field
|
Hours
|
Grade
|
Comments
|
|
|
Students can select any four business electives, complete
a concentration in marketing, management, operations and technology
management and management information systems; create a customized group of
directed electives (with department approval); or complete a minor
in a different field of study (see the catalog for minors).
